Output 6ccfc8d13ed42d913df764d7d02db2ead96615b782ca146d7bbe338e9c092028:21

value
9578908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5409a4580bc82c581840f67b944fbe7fd8138bbb OP_EQUAL
address
MFZWYUmpdiMSTvaxHixCYoPxtgqLmZDtHs
transaction
6ccfc8d13ed42d913df764d7d02db2ead96615b782ca146d7bbe338e9c092028
spent
true